WHAT IS SOFTWARE?

Software is the set of instructions and programs that tell your computer, phone, tablet, or other devices what to do and how to do it. You can’t touch software the way you can touch a keyboard or screen—it’s invisible digital “brain power” that makes hardware useful.

Think of it this way:

  • Hardware = the physical body of your device (the parts you can see and touch).
  • Software = the mind, personality, and skills that make the body actually work.
  • Without software, your computer is just an expensive box of metal and plastic. With software, it becomes a tool for work, entertainment, communication, shopping, learning, and almost everything else in modern life.

COMMON TERMS YOU MIGHT HEAR

  • App → Short for application (phones/tablets)
  • Program / Software → Often used the same way
  • Cloud software → Runs over the internet (Netflix) instead of being installed on your device
  • Freeware / Free software → Costs nothing to use
  • Paid / Subscription software → You pay once or monthly (Microsoft 365)
  • Open-source software → Free and the code is public (Firefox)

How Software Is Made and Updated

Programmers write code (detailed instructions) using programming languages. That code gets turned into a program or app you can install or use.

Software companies regularly release updates to:

  • Fix bugs (mistakes)
  • Add new features
  • Improve speed or security
  • Protect against new hacker tricks
  • That’s why you see “Update available” notifications—it’s like giving your device a tune-up.
